We are seeking an experienced Electronics Engineer to join our engineering team and play a key role in the design, development, and lifecycle management of embedded electronic products. This role will be heavily involved in the technical aspects of projects from concept through to production, contributing across electronics, mechanical considerations, ERP systems, and product compliance activities. The successful candidate will work closely with development teams, suppliers, and production to deliver innovative, reliable solutions while ensuring compliance with relevant safety and EMC standards.

Key Responsibilities:- Design of novel electronic solutions, including full life cycle from schematic and component selection to PCB layout and prototype testing, in accordance with design specifications.
- Developing embedded C/C++ firmware for PIC or NXP Embedded microcontrollers or similar.
- Must be able to examine and understand existing deployed firmware and provide bug fixes with minimal risk.
- Documenting technical solutions and processes including the capturing of the requirements of new product developments and the generation of in-depth specifications from minimal source material.
- BOM Data management for new and existing products in the ERP System.
- Functional design proving including both firmware and hardware.
- Production testing solution design and implementation i.e. Production Tester firmware/software and hardware rigs.
- Assisting 2nd line support and production teams with technical queries.
- Providing guidance to other team members.
